No you're not having any authority problems. None of these
messages are
relevant. They are just warnings caused by the real error.
Chances are that somewhere in your list of messages is something to
the
effect of "Unable to resolve to symbol xxxx" - _that_ is the
message to take
note of.
Have you specified a binding directory? The binder has to have a
way to
locate all of the subprocedures etc. that it needs. If you are
using
CRTBNDRPG the only way to do that is to use a binding directory
that
identifies the Service Program(s) needed.
If you have used a binding directory, then you have probably
misspelled a
name - again the "Unable to ..." message will show the way.
